US real estate market
The US real estate market can offer investors higher returns for a limited amount of funds. When the American market is compared with those of Europe and the UK, the rent-to-values are higher and the country is also regarded as safe and stable. For British investors there is the added attraction of a common language. The US has an extensive pool of renters and the government ensures that investing in property in America is tax efficient. There are various ways that a foreign investor can invest in order to reduce their tax exposure. Despite recent economic upheavals, the US dollar remains a stable currency. The US places no restrictions on foreign nationals owning property in the US and the legal process for buying property is transparent which gives buyers confidence. This does not, however, mean that investors do not need to do some research before they commit themselves, as with any other type of investment there are good and bad investments.
US investment property – tourism
The US is a diverse country with a climate that varies from the freezing winters of the northern states to the mild all-year round sunshine of the southern states, therefore depending on where the property is it can appeal to a variety of potential renters, whether they are sun-seekers or skiers. The cost of living in the US is generally lower than in many other countries, and it can offer people an enviable lifestyle with plenty of opportunities for outdoor sports and other activities. The US is also well served by direct flights from a large number of international airports, ensuring easy access to many parts of the US.
The US is a popular holiday destination and the rental market is fuelled both by the foreign visitors who come to the US each year (reaching a record 62 million in 2011) and the internal migration of people from the north to the south. The latter makes long-term rental property for sale in Florida or Las Vegas particularly attractive. Some regions of the US have not been exploited yet and, with the right advice, investors have the chance to buy in an emerging market.
US investment property – wide range of rentals
The US has a wide range of property types, from condo homes to units in condo hotels. Investors can buy property in cities or in very small towns, in the suburbs or in a large metropolitan area. There are also off-plan schemes which can offer investors the potential for good capital growth. Having such a variety of properties on offer, investors can attract various groups such as students, young working couples, families, tourists or retired people.
US investment property – low entry requirements
Investing in property in America is an appealing market to young or new investors because the amount of capital required to enter the market is lower than it would be in other countries. In addition, even if the economy is struggling, investors who buy rental properties can get immediate returns on their money.
